The ADNS-5000 is a one-chip USB optical mouse sensor for implementing a non-mechanical tracking engine for computer mice.

It is based on optical navigation technology that measures changes in position by optically acquiring sequential surface images frames and mathematically determining the direction and magnitude of movement.

The sensor is in a 18-pin optical package that is designed to be used with the ADNS-5100 Round Lens or ADNS5100-001 Trim Lens, the ADNS-5200 Clip, and the HLMPED80-XX000 LED. These parts provide a complete and compact mouse sensor. There are no moving parts, and precision optical alignment is not required, facilitating high volume assembly.

Default resolution is as 500 counts per inch, with rates of motion up to 16 inches per second and 2g acceleration. Resolution can also be programmed to 1000 cpi. Frame rate is varied internally by the sensor to achieve tracking and speed performance, eliminating the need for the use of many registers.

A complete mouse can be built with the addition of a PC board, switches, mechanical Z-wheel, plastic case and cable. A 1% pull up resistor is needed for the USB port to signify a low speed HID device.

Theory of Operation

The ADNS-5000 is based on Optical Navigation Technology. It contains an Image Acquisition System IAS , a Digital Signal Processor DSP and USB stream output.

The IAS acquires microscopic surface images via the lens and illumination system provided by the ADNS-5100 Round Lens or ADNS-5100-001 Trim Lens, ADNS-5200, and HLMP-ED80-XX000. These images are processed by the DSP to determine the direction and distance of motion. The DSP generates the 'x and 'y relative displacement values which are converted to USB motion data.

The components interlock as they are mounted onto features on the base plate.

The ADNS-5000 sensor is designed for mounting on a through hole PCB, looking down. The aperture stop and features on the package align it to the lens See

The ADNS-5100 Round lens provides optics for the imaging of the surface as well as illumination of the surface at the optimum angle. Lens features align it to the sensor, base plate, and clip with the LED. The lens also has a large
round to provide a long creepage path for any ESD events that occur at the opening of the base plate See

The ADNS-5200 clip holds the LED in relation to the lens. The LED must be inserted into the clip and the LED’s leads formed prior to loading on the PCB.

The HLMP-ED80-XX000 LED is recommended for illumination. If used with the bin table, illumination can be guaranteed.
